Ammonium dimolybdate
Molecular formula | (NH4)2Mo2O7 | ||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
Introduction | Commonly known as: ADM, Use (NH4)2Mo2O7 to present. White crystalline powder. Product contains no visible inclusion. Well soluble in water and alkali and insoluble in alcohol and acetone. Obtain ammonium dimolybdate by evaporation. Mainly used to produce molybdenum powder for metallurgy and trace element fertilizer and produce ceramic pigment and other molybdenum compound pigments. | ||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
